QuickBooks Desktop Error 1321 is generally an installation or update-related error. It can appear when the QuickBooks installer does not have sufficient permission to modify a particular file. Windows security settings, restricted folder permissions, antivirus software, or a damaged installation can interfere with the installation process.
Error 1321 is usually connected with file-access or permission problems in Windows. The installer needs to modify specific QuickBooks files, but Windows or another program may prevent that action.
Common causes include:
QuickBooks does not have sufficient permission to access a required file.
The Windows user account has restricted permissions.
The QuickBooks installer is not running with administrator privileges.
Antivirus or security software is blocking the installation.
A previous QuickBooks installation was incomplete.
QuickBooks installation files are damaged.
Windows folder permissions have been changed.
A file is being used by another application.
The Windows user profile is damaged.
Multiple QuickBooks components are conflicting during installation.
Windows system files are corrupted.
If you see a file path in the Error 1321 message, note it carefully. It can identify the exact file or folder that QuickBooks is unable to modify. A simple restart should be your first troubleshooting step because another Windows process may be using a QuickBooks file. Restarting the computer can release locked files and temporary system resources.
Follow these steps:
Close QuickBooks Desktop.
Close the installation window.
Save your work in other applications.
Click the Start button.
Select Power.
Click Restart.
Wait for Windows to restart.
Sign in again.
Start the QuickBooks installation or update.
Check whether Error 1321 appears again.
If the error was caused by a temporary file lock, restarting Windows may resolve it. Running the QuickBooks installer with administrator privileges can resolve problems caused by restricted Windows permissions. This is one of the simplest solutions to try when Error 1321 appears.
Use this process:
Locate the QuickBooks installation file.
Right-click the installation file.
Select Run as administrator.
Click Yes when Windows displays the User Account Control prompt.
Follow the QuickBooks installation instructions.
Allow the installer to complete.
Restart the computer if requested.
Open QuickBooks Desktop.
Check whether the problem has been resolved.
If you are installing QuickBooks from a downloaded file, make sure the installer has been downloaded from a trusted source. Security software can sometimes prevent QuickBooks from modifying installation files. If antivirus protection is blocking the installer, temporarily disabling it can help determine whether it is responsible for Error 1321.
Follow these steps carefully:
Close QuickBooks Desktop.
Open your antivirus or security software.
Temporarily pause its protection if appropriate.
Start the QuickBooks installation again.
Check whether Error 1321 appears.
If the installation completes, restart antivirus protection immediately.
Add QuickBooks to the software's trusted or allowed list if necessary.
Restart the computer.
Open QuickBooks and test it.
Do not keep antivirus protection disabled unnecessarily. If Error 1321 continues even after temporarily checking the security software, restore normal protection and continue troubleshooting. If the error message identifies a particular folder or file, insufficient permissions for that location may be preventing QuickBooks from completing its installation. Adjusting permissions can sometimes resolve the problem.
Before changing permissions, make sure you understand the folder mentioned in the error message.
Try these steps:
Locate the folder shown in the Error 1321 message.
Right-click the folder.
Select Properties.
Open the Security tab.
Select your Windows user account.
Check the permissions assigned to the account.
Make sure the account has appropriate access to the folder.
Apply the required permission changes.
Click Apply and then OK.
Restart the QuickBooks installation.
Avoid changing permissions on important Windows system folders unless you know exactly what you are doing. Incorrect permissions can create additional security problems. If QuickBooks is already installed and Error 1321 appears while updating or repairing the software, using the Windows repair option may restore damaged QuickBooks components.
Follow these steps:
Close QuickBooks Desktop.
Open the Windows Control Panel.
Select Programs and Features.
Locate QuickBooks Desktop in the installed programs list.
Select QuickBooks.
Click Uninstall/Change.
Select the Repair option if available.
Follow the instructions shown on the screen.
Wait for the repair process to complete.
Restart Windows.
Open QuickBooks Desktop.
Try the update again.
Repairing QuickBooks should not be confused with deleting your company files. However, maintaining a recent backup is recommended. Error 1321 can occur when another application is using a file that QuickBooks needs to modify. Closing unnecessary applications can release the file.
Try these steps:
Close QuickBooks Desktop.
Close Microsoft Office and other applications.
Close file-management windows that may be accessing the QuickBooks folder.
Check whether another QuickBooks process is running.
Restart Windows if necessary.
Run the QuickBooks installer again as administrator.
Check whether Error 1321 appears.
If the installation works after closing another program, that application may have been locking the QuickBooks file.
